Title

PERFORMANCE EVALUATION OF NANOSCALE ZERO-VALENT IRON ADSORBED ON CALCIUM ALGINATE IN NITRATE REDUCTION IN AQUEOUS SYSTEMS

Pages

  67-75

Abstract

 There is nowadays a growing concern about NITRATE pollution in groundwater resources and its adverse impacts on the public health. The present experimental study was conducted to evaluate the efficiency of the Fe° CALCIUM ALGINATE process in NITRATE reduction. For this purpose, the effect of Fe° adsorbed on CALCIUM ALGINATE on NITRATE oxidation was investigated at a pH range of 2 to10, a contact time of 10 to 90 min, NITRATE concentrations of 50 to 300 mg/L and with calcium alginat concentrations of 0.5, 1, and 2 mg/L. NITRATE level in the effluent was measured using spectrophotometry. Results showed that a pH level of 3 and a contact time of 15 min were the optimal values in the Fenton process for NITRATE removal. Under these conditions, NITRATE removal efficiencies for FeIII, FeII, Feo, FeII/Feo/H2O2, and FeIII/Feo/H2O2 were 10.5, 27.6, 36.5, 62.3, and 74%, respectively, for a retention time of 90 min, an initial NITRATE concentration of 100 mg/L, an iron concentration of 10 mg/L, and a pH level of 4. The results indicate that the corrective fenton process with zero iron nano-particles can effectively reduce NITRATE under optimal conditions and that this method can be successfully used for the removal of similar compounds.
